gcc: snprintf may need here upto 18 bytes
Although hypothetical case....
---
daemons/lvmlockd/lvmlockd-core.c | 2 +-
1 file changed, 1 insertion(+), 1 deletion(-)
diff --git a/daemons/lvmlockd/lvmlockd-core.c b/daemons/lvmlockd/lvmlockd-core.c
index 175f59331..6d0d4d98c 100644
--- a/daemons/lvmlockd/lvmlockd-core.c
+++ b/daemons/lvmlockd/lvmlockd-core.c
@@ -4777,7 +4777,7 @@ static void client_recv_action(struct client *cl)
const char *path;
const char *str;
struct pvs pvs;
- char buf[17]; /* "path[%d]\0", %d outputs signed integer so max to 10 bytes */
+ char buf[18]; /* "path[%d]\0", %d outputs signed integer so max to 10 bytes */
int64_t val;
uint32_t opts = 0;
int result = 0;
